Airsoft Guns As An Enthusiast Activity
Airsoft guns as an enthusiast activity can bring many hours of enjoyment, especially when one takes some time to learn a little bit about what these toy replica guns can do for most hobbyists. It's a fact that these sorts of replica weapons fire rubber BBs or BBs that are composed of soft plastic at velocities such that a lot of fun can be created without a lot of potential harm.
For the most part, these replica guns are extremely detailed, and can resemble the actual thing in every aspect, at least to the untrained eye. They come in a variety of types and kinds, including handguns, shotguns and rifles -- especially those kinds of rifles that looked like the military version, such as the M4 carbine.
For some reason, most enthusiasts seem to gravitate toward the rifle versions of these airsoft guns. The most popular model of replica gun sold is currently that M4 carbine with an under barrel grenade launcher. Usually, most manufacturers of these kinds of replica guns include a brightly colored tip at the end of the barrel or muzzle. It's there for a reason.
Most such airsoft guns are powered electrically, meaning an onboard rechargeable battery will power a piston that generates enough air to push one of those soft plastic or rubber BBs out of the barrel at around 300 ft./s of velocity, which is quick enough to make role-playing or team against team shooter competitions extremely enjoyable and exciting.
If deciding that taking up airsoft guns as a hobby is going to be a good idea, it's a smart first step, then, to head to the Internet to see what sort of replica weapons will be available and how much they'll cost to purchase. Normally, a quality replica of something like the M4 carbine will run from $50 for a purely plastic model up to $300 for one that has lots of accessories and is composed partly of metal.
Depending on what sort of use the airsoft guns are going to be put to (combat-style competitions, team against team shoot outs etc.) there are several pieces of gear that will need to be added. This will include some sort of tactical harness or vest where additional magazines that hold BBs can be stored along with one or two extra battery packs that can be swapped out in the middle of a firefight.
Batteries that are employed for use in airsoft guns are rechargeable and will initially require at least four hours before they can be put into use. After that, keep in mind that it's a good idea to fully drain the battery before recharging it in order to ensure the battery doesn't create a faulty memory and shut the weapon down during the middle of a firefight.
